Cranberry Salsa
Ingredients:
- 2 cups fresh cranberries
- 1 orange, peeled and segmented
- 1/2 cup fresh cilantro, chopped
- 1/4 cup red onion, finely diced
- 1 jalapeño, seeds removed and finely chopped
- 1/2 cup granulated sugar
- 1/4 teaspoon salt
Cooking Steps:
Step 1: Prepare Cranberries Rinse fresh cranberries under cold water and remove any stems.
Step 2: Combine Ingredients In a food processor, pulse cranberries, orange segments, cilantro, red onion, and jalapeño until coarsely chopped.
Step 3: Sweeten and Season Transfer the chopped mixture to a bowl. Add granulated sugar and salt, adjusting to taste. Mix well to combine.
Step 4: Refrigerate Cover the bowl and refrigerate for at least 1-2 hours to allow the flavors to meld.
Step 5: Serve Bring Cranberry Salsa to room temperature before serving. Enjoy it as a side, topping, or dip for a burst of festive flavors.
